Job Description : A Release Train Engineer (RTE) responsible as serving as a coach for an Agile Release Train (ART), for a long-term, cross-functional team of agile teams. The role includes facilitating ART events and processes, helping teams deliver value by coordinating impediment removal, managing risks, and communicating with stakeholders. They are responsible for guiding the ART's execution and helping to improve its overall performance Facilitation: Lead and facilitate ART events, including Program Increment (PI) planning, system demos, and Inspect & Adapt workshops. Coaching and guidance: Act as a servant leader and coach for the ART and its constituent agile teams, embodying and promoting agile principles. Impediment management: Help teams identify and remove impediments to their progress, escalating issues when necessary. Risk and dependency management: Facilitate the identification, tracking, and resolution of program risks, assumptions, and dependencies. Communication: Communicate with stakeholders to ensure alignment and manage expectations. Continuous improvement: Help the ART and its teams to continuously improve their processes and delivery capabilities. Process support: Support the execution of the ART's processes, such as tracking feature completion in the Kanban.
